From: Rasmus Andersson Date: Wed, 11 Aug 2010 21:03:56 +0000 (+0200) Subject: Added support for multiple listeners to DNS multicast datagrams. X-Git-Tag: v0.1.104~11 X-Git-Url: http://review.tizen.org/git/?a=commitdiff_plain;h=8d5e05668bf67e872a200a89c8414d2601c95520;p=platform%2Fupstream%2Fnodejs.git Added support for multiple listeners to DNS multicast datagrams.
